Professional Career

In the 2006 MLB Draft, Bard was selected 28th overall by the Boston Red Sox, marking the beginning of his journey to the major leagues. He quickly rose through the ranks of the minor league system, showcasing his talent and determination along the way. Bard's hard work paid off when he made his MLB debut in 2009, fulfilling a lifelong dream.
